Water-Resistance Ratings Explained
The water resistance of watches is often measured in meters (m) or atmospheres (ATM). Here's what these ratings mean:
- 30 meters (3 ATM): This is the lowest level of water resistance you will find in watches. A watch with this rating can resist water splashes, such as when you're caught in the rain or washing your hands. However, it is not suitable for swimming or showering, since it's only designed to resist light moisture.
- 50 meters (5 ATM): A watch rated to 50 meters endures splashes and brief immersion, so it's suitable for shallow water. This would include hand-washing or light swimming in shallow water. It's a far cry from ideal for in-depth water exposure, say for high-impact activities.
- 100 meters (10 ATM): The watch that has such a rating already can join most events connected with water, including swimming, snorkelling, and some light water sports. These watches can take up greater pressure; however, one shall not apply them in cases of diving or speed performances in water.
- 200 meters (20 ATM): This is a common rating for divers' watches and means the watch can sustain more demanding water-based activities. It's ideal for swimming, diving, and snorkelling where greater pressure is involved. However, these watches still mustn't be used for deep-sea diving without extra features.
- 300 meters (30 ATM): Although rating it to 300 meters, means serious condition such as diving. It is said best for professional divers. From its name, the dive, the watch will become resilient during deep sea, activities, and high-running speed water sports.
- 500 meters (50 ATM) and above: A watch with such a rating is designed for extreme conditions, including deep-sea diving and professional aquatic explorations. These are very specialized timepieces, and the advanced technologies to deal with such substantial underwater pressure are often implemented.

Screw-Down Crown
The screw-down crown is an essential feature in water-resistant watches. By securely tightening the crown, water is prevented from entering through the crown, which is a common vulnerability in non-water-resistant watches. This feature enhances the watch’s overall resistance to water and ensures its internal components stay dry.

Tips for Maintaining Water Resistance
Even if your watch is rated for water resistance, it’s important to maintain its performance and ensure it stays functional in water-related activities. Following are some very useful tips for the extension of life and functionality of your water-resistant timepiece:
- Regularly Check the Seals: Over time, the rubber or silicone seals that protect your watch may wear down, causing them to lose their effectiveness. It’s recommended that you have your watch serviced every few years, especially if you frequently expose it to water.
- Avoid Sudden Temperature Changes: Large temperature changes will expand and contract the materials, such as rubber and metals, that make up your watch, possibly affecting the water resistance. Do not expose your water-resistant watch to extreme temperature changes, such as from a hot sauna into cold pool water.
- Don’t Operate Pushers or Crowns Underwater: Besides, water can enter if actions such as operating the crown or pushers-for time setting and chronograph functions are performed underwater. At all times, the crown must be screwed down completely before touching the water.
- Rinse After Exposure to Saltwater: Saltwater creates corrosion, which might also destroy the parts that keep your watch ticking. This is why you're highly recommended to rinse your timepiece under fresh water after an overheating swim or shower in salt water, in order to rid it of the deposits left on it.
- Avoid Hot Water: While most water-resistant watches can survive a degree of water, hot water does cause the seals to lose their integrity. Therefore, it's best to take off your watch before entering a hot shower, sauna, or hot tub.
